Garnettius hungerfordi
Taxonomy
Mazonia hungerfordi was named by Elias (1937). Its type specimen is USNM 125453, an exoskeleton, and it is a compression fossil. Its type locality is 6 miles northwest of Garnett, which is in a Kasimovian estuary/bay shale in the Stanton Formation of Kansas. It is the type species of Garnettius.
It was considered a nomen nudum by Elias (1936); it was recombined as Garnettius hungerfordi by Petrunkevitch (1953), Kjellesvig-Waering (1986), Dunlop et al. (2013).

Synonymy list
Year | Name and author |
---|---|
1937 | Mazonia hungerfordi Elias p. 335 fig. 3n |
1953 | Garnettius hungerfordi Petrunkevitch p. 34 figs. 36-39, 125 |
1986 | Garnettius hungerfordi Kjellesvig-Waering p. 114 figs. 46, 47B-K, 48 |
2013 | Garnettius hungerfordi Dunlop et al. p. 31 |
